摘要
本文分析建筑节能的意义,并针对混凝土空心砌块存在的热工性能差的问题,研制了复合混凝土空心砌块。通过对实测结果和计算数据分析表明,两种复合混凝土空心砌块分别达到到节能30%和节能50%的要求,并均具有防裂、抗渗、耐久性好,易施工,造价低廉等特点,是一种较为理想的节能型墙体材料,它为混凝土空心砌块的发展开辟了一条新途径。
This paper analyzes the significance of energy saving for buildings. The compound concrete hollow blocks have been developed to improve the poor thermotechnical effect existed in normal concrete hollow blocks. Test data and calcuations show that the two types of compound concrete hollow blocks have achieved respectively the requirements for energy saving of 30 percent or 50 percent, and also have the advantages of crack prevention, impermeability, durability, lowerprice and easiness in construction, As a relatively ideal wall material of energy saving, the compound concrete hollow blocks have opened a new way to the development of concrete hollow blocks.
